To improve the contribution workflow and drive community involvement, we need feedback on the process we have established. Anyone is welcome to weigh in on this issue by commenting and describing your experience and/or how it could be improved; no need to assign yourself. For now, this issue is just a discussion. New sub-issues can be created to address necessary changes that get agreed upon through discussion.

You might have feedback on:
Are the issue descriptions clear? Do you know what you should do?
Is it difficult or easy to coordinate your work with other contributors (as needed)?
Are there issues you feel you can contribute to?
Are the issue templates useful?
Does CONTRIBUTING.md need revision?
Does the system for acknowledging contributors need revision?
Anything else related to contributing
